Frequently Asked Questions
What is a perpetual plaque and how does it work?
A perpetual plaque is one wall-mounted board that records a new honoree each cycle instead of issuing a separate award every time. A decorated header plate names the program at the top, and the smaller plates below it get engraved as each winner is chosen. The board stays on the wall for years, so a school or office adds a name rather than buying a whole new award.
Is a piano finish perpetual plaque better than ordering a new plaque every year?
A perpetual plaque suits programs that run for years, because the board is bought once and only the plate engraving repeats. An individual plaque gives each winner something to take home, which a wall board cannot do. Many committees run both formats: the perpetual board in the lobby and a small keepsake award for the recipient.
What is a piano finish plaque actually made of?
Piano finish is a wood board sealed under a high-gloss lacquer, the same mirror-style coating used on piano cabinets. The engraving plates carry a gold or chrome finish and take laser engraving directly into the metal surface. Laser engraving cuts the lettering in rather than printing it on, so the text does not rub off during handling or cleaning.

What kinds of recognition programs use a perpetual plaque with 12 plates?
Perpetual plaques fit any program that names one honoree per cycle over several years, and 12 plates covers a full year of monthly awards or 12 years of annual ones. Common uses include employee of the month boards, safety record tracking, volunteer of the year, fire and police department honors, scholarship recipients, and martial arts or golf club champions. Service clubs and churches also use the format for past-president and long-service lists.

How do I clean a piano finish plaque without dulling the gloss?
Wipe the board with a dry or barely damp microfiber cloth, working with the grain of the finish. Ammonia glass cleaners and abrasive pads dull lacquer and leave fine scratches, so keep both away from the surface. Hang the board out of direct sunlight and clear of heating vents, since heat and UV fade a lacquered wood panel over time.
